Recognizing bid Bonds: Definition and Objective
bid bonds play a vital role in construction jobs, serving as an economic warranty that a professional will certainly recognize their bid if selected. When you send a bid, you're basically committing to finish the task at the proposed price.
a bid bond guarantees that, if you win the contract, you'll follow through. It secures job owners from the danger of service providers backing out or stopping working to satisfy their obligations. Generally, the bond quantity is a percent of the total bid, offering a safety net for the project proprietor.
How bid Bonds Work in Construction Projects
In building and construction projects, comprehending how bid bonds function is crucial for both specialists and job proprietors. a bid bond functions as a warranty that you, as a professional, will certainly meet your contract responsibilities if granted the task.
When you submit a bid, you include the bid bond, typically a portion of your bid quantity. If you win the agreement and stop working to proceed, the job owner can claim the bond quantity, compensating them for the loss.
This procedure aids guarantee that you're serious about your proposal and have the financial capability to finish the work. By needing bid bonds, proprietors can shield their passions and advertise responsibility amongst contractors, promoting an extra reputable bidding atmosphere.
